
Dartmoor National Park
Bovey Castle is located in the Dartmoor National Park. It is an incredible area of natural beauty and heritage, set in the heart of south west England. It was the fourth National Park to be created as an area to be protected in 1951.

The History of Bovey Castle
In 1890, William Henry Smith (WH Smith, later to become Viscount Hambleden) purchased 5,000 acres of land from the Earl of Devon for £103,000.

The estate consisted of several large ancient manors, including Moretonhampstead and North Bovey; almost thirty farms, extensive woodland and fishing rights on the rivers Bovey and Teign.

It was his son, Frederick, who built the Manor House in a lavish neo-Elizabethan style as one of the family's numerous country retreats.

Pool and Gym
Housed in the Orangery, the hotel’s indoor Art Deco swimming pool overlooks the sun terrace and the River Bovey, offering stunning views for miles over Dartmoor National Park. Bovey Castle’s spa facilities also include a jacuzzi, sauna and steam room. The hotel gym is stocked with a full range of Precor, cardiovascular and strength equipment.
